Can I use pop-ups or banners on my website to highlight Bing Ads incentives?

Yes, you can use pop-ups or banners on your website to highlight Bing Ads incentives effectively. Here's how you can do it while ensuring a positive user experience:

1. **Clear and Relevant Messaging**: Ensure that the pop-up or banner clearly communicates the Bing Ads incentives or offers. Use concise and compelling language that grabs attention and encourages users to take action.

2. **Eye-Catching Design**: Use visually appealing design elements that align with your brand but also stand out on the page. Consider using contrasting colors, compelling imagery related to the offer, or animations to attract attention.

3. **Non-intrusive Placement**: Place the pop-up or banner strategically so that it's noticeable but not disruptive to the user experience. Avoid covering essential content or interfering with navigation, especially on mobile devices.

4. **Targeting and Timing**: Use targeting options to display the pop-up or banner to relevant visitors who are likely to be interested in Bing Ads incentives. Consider triggering it based on user behavior, such as time spent on the site or specific pages visited.

5. **Clear Call to Action (CTA)**: Include a clear and prominent call to action that directs users to take the next step, such as "Learn More," "Get Started," or "Claim Offer Now." Make it easy for users to understand what they need to do next.

6. **A/B Testing**: Experiment with different versions of the pop-up or banner to determine which design, messaging, or placement resonates best with your audience. Use A/B testing to optimize performance and maximize conversions.

7. **Mobile Optimization**: Ensure that the pop-up or banner is mobile-friendly and doesn't interfere with the user experience on smaller screens. Consider using smaller, less intrusive formats for mobile devices.

8. **Compliance and User Consent**: Ensure compliance with privacy regulations (such as GDPR or CCPA) regarding the use of pop-ups and banners. Provide users with an option to easily dismiss or close the pop-up if they prefer not to engage with it.

By implementing these best practices, you can effectively use pop-ups or banners on your website to highlight Bing Ads incentives while maintaining a positive user experience and maximizing engagement with your offers.
